Mobile police arrested the alleged gunman in a Tuesday night shooting at a police car on Flicker Drive.
Valeido L. Davidson, 32, was arrested late Wednesday and booked into Mobile Metro Jail on charges of shooting into an occupied vehicle and two counts of shooting into an unoccupied dwelling.
The incident occurred in the 1600 block of Flicker Street around 8:50 p.m.
While officers were in the area near Michigan Avenue and Duval Street, an “unknown male” began firing at their vehicle and two unoccupied buildings, according to a Mobile police spokeswoman.
No one was injured.
Mobile Police Chief Paul Prine told a local TV news outlet on Wednesday that the shooting was unprovoked.
He also said the police officers did not shoot back.
